How To Make A Memorable Speech
Career : Career Techniques Memorable speeces - these are the ones where, after a day of conference lectures, the delegates go away and can actually remember what one of the speakers says. It may sound cruel, but how many times have you attented presentations only to remember precious little of what was said at the end of the day? To avoid this fate yourself, you need to remember to have a few key messages you want to make, then not go into too much extra detail. Why? Due to attention span, partly, and because you don't want to give a lecture instead. If you have three key points you want to make and ensure you get into people's heads - and do so - then that's actually a big success of your speech. Tip: try to add a little wit and humour. Why? It keeps people interested in what you are saying, and in addition to that, it makes it more likely for them to remember your serious points.
